设计一个对银行账户余额操作的程序
假设账号: int account=666666
密码:int password=111111
余额:int balance=1000
进入程序输出选择操作选项:
1.存款,2.取款,3.查询余额
要求使用Scanner交互式操作.
存款,取款,查询均需要输入账号密码,验证没有问题即可操作.
可以多次重复操作
package lianxi;
import java.util.Scanner;
public class bc02 {
public static void main(String[] args) {
Scanner s = new Scanner(System.in);
int balance = 1000;
a:while (true) {
System.out.println("请输入账号");
int account = s.nextInt();
System.out.println("请输入密码");
int password = s.nextInt();
while (account == 666666 && password == 111111) {
//System.out.println("登陆成功");
System.out.println("进入程序输出选择操作选项:\n" +
"\t1.存款,2.取款,3.查询余额 4.退出");
int n = s.nextInt();
if (n == 1) {
System.out.println("输入存款数目");
int c = s.nextInt();
balance += c;
continue;
}
if (n == 2) {
System.out.println("输入取款数目");
int q = s.nextInt();
balance -= q;
continue;
}
if (n == 3) {
System.out.println("查询存款余额结果");
System.out.println("您的存款余额为" + balance + "元");
continue;
}
if (n == 4)
break a;
}
}
}
}